Did you miss out on your high school prom?

Did you go but wish it never ended?

Do you hate proms but love your bike?

If you answered yes to any of these questions, then you may need to find yourself a date for the...

***Bike Rider's Ball!***
A Recyclistas and Bike Lab Event

Friday April 27 – Wednesday May 2
Victoria, BC

Bike Inspired Art Show, Race, Rides, Dance Troupes, Bike Polo, Live Music, Costumes, Food and one heck of a Prom. This weekend bash is to raise money for the Bike Lab Society's Youth Programs. Be there!

More information to come.
